Statement of Claim
Claimant says:
"I need help with someone checking this bank who ever they are. I bought a 2007 GT 6 Pontiac in June 2012. I had complain before to you about the Vaden Nissan Dealer that sold me the lemon. They called me but nothing was done about it. I am paying $17.00 Dollars for Maintenance and everytime something breaks in the car, it's not covered. I want them to stop Charging me for a Maintenance Insurance I never asked for. Another thing is the bank Flagship, is ripping me off, the Car Value was on the windshield for $13.000. It went up even with my 2002 Mazda trade to almost $16000 dollars, I just sat there in their office while they try to get this used car approved, well they did, to my worse nightmare, I went thru all the papers I sign and to my shock, I am paying Flagship almost $30.000 Dollars for a used car that's been in the shop so much I lost count, money out of my pocket. Well I wanted to drop the according to Vaden Nissan the Maintenance Insurance that doesn't cover nothing that breaks and I feel I should be able to drop it. I didn't ask for this. Ok, Flagship Bank is charging me $381.42 a Month for this Lemon, and If I want to make payment over the Phone cause I am busy at work they charge me $10.00 Dollars more. If I go to their website I had to use western Union and they Charge me $5.00 dollars more. This is a crooked place and Vaden said it's now between my bank and I. I feel if I didnt qualify for this loan to get this lemon they sold me they just should it tell me and not take me a mile to hell. When I send the payment in the mail, I always send it on time so it gets there early, now it's not problem if mail is delayed for whatever reason, well they charge me late fees. I want to return this car back to Vaden Nissan and close what ever the contact they made with Flagship. I know I probably won't get my Mazda back, but if I owe anything to them for returning this car they can take it from My 2002 Mazda I gave as a Trade. I am willing to get an offer from Both parties, if not I'll have to go Higher with this problem and this Bank especially. This crooked Bank. From the $381.42 they only put down towards my payment like $20 Or $30 dollars everything else goes to interest. I never heard such a thing only yeah with Tittle Max.. Please look into it and help me. I can be paying $15. 000 dollars in interest,. Not for this lemon, that keeps breaking up on me, when it's not one thing is another. Its not fair what they did to me. All they had to say it was NO and that would it been all. Please help. Vaden it's not going to help they say it's not their problem anymore. Sure they got their commision selling this Lemon to a first time buyer now no one want to help or listen."

  • I have a few questions as to your claim here. Perhaps writing up another comment and updating your claim here will help the company respond appropriately to what you are looking for. It seems from reading the claim that you are having a problem with a car financing company? It seems you may have concerns about how they are applying your payment? Typically, in a financing arrangement, the majority of the payment, at least for the beginning of the loan, goes towards interest, and a very small amount goes towards principal. Towards the end of the loan is when the bulk of the payment goes towards principal payments.
